Minimizing phosphorus sorption and leaching in a tropical acid soil using Egypt rock phosphate with organic amendments

The study examined changes in soil phosphorus sorption and desorption, pH buffering capacity, and phosphorus leaching upon application of organic amendments (chicken litter biochar and pineapple leaf residues compost).
